@available(iOS 16.0, *)
struct SendMessageIntent: AppIntent {
static var title: LocalizedStringResource = "Send Message"
static var description = IntentDescription("Send a message to a chat channel")
static var isDiscoverable = true
static var openAppWhenRun = false
@Parameter(title: "Channel ID")
var channelId: String?
@Parameter(title: "Message Content")
var content: String?
func perform() async throws -> some IntentResult & ReturnsValue<String> & ProvidesDialog {
guard let channelId = channelId, !channelId.isEmpty else {
throw AppIntentError.executionFailed("Channel ID is required")
}
guard let content = content, !content.isEmpty else {
throw AppIntentError.executionFailed("Message content is required")
}
let plugin = FlutterAppIntentsPlugin.shared
let result = await plugin.handleIntentInvocation(
identifier: "send_message",
parameters: ["channelId": channelId, "content": content]
)
if let success = result["success"] as? Bool, success {
let value = result["value"] as? String ?? "Message sent"
return .result(
value: value,
dialog: "\(value)"
)
} else {
let errorMessage = result["error"] as? String ?? "Failed to send message"
throw AppIntentError.executionFailed(errorMessage)
}
}
}

Future<AppIntentResult> _handleSendMessageIntent(
Map<String, dynamic> parameters,
) async {
try {
final channelId = parameters['channelId'] as String?;
final content = parameters['content'] as String?;
if (channelId == null) {
throw ArgumentError('channelId is required');
}
if (content == null || content.isEmpty) {
throw ArgumentError('content is required');
}
talker.info('[AppIntents] Sending message to $channelId: $content');
if (_dio == null) {
return AppIntentResult.failed(error: 'API client not initialized');
}
try {
final nonce = _generateNonce();
await _dio!.post(
'/messager/chat/$channelId/messages',
data: {'content': content, 'nonce': nonce},
);
talker.info('[AppIntents] Message sent successfully');
return AppIntentResult.successful(
value: 'Message sent to channel $channelId',
needsToContinueInApp: false,
);
} on DioException catch (e) {
talker.error('[AppIntents] API error sending message', e);
return AppIntentResult.failed(
error: 'Failed to send message: ${e.message ?? 'Network error'}',
);
}
} catch (e, stack) {
talker.error('[AppIntents] Failed to send message', e, stack);
return AppIntentResult.failed(error: 'Failed to send message: $e');
}
}
Future<AppIntentResult> _handleReadMessagesIntent(
Map<String, dynamic> parameters,
) async {
try {
final channelId = parameters['channelId'] as String?;
final limitParam = parameters['limit'] as String?;
final limit = limitParam != null ? int.tryParse(limitParam) ?? 5 : 5;
if (channelId == null) {
throw ArgumentError('channelId is required');
}
if (limit < 1 || limit > 20) {
return AppIntentResult.failed(error: 'limit must be between 1 and 20');
}
talker.info('[AppIntents] Reading $limit messages from $channelId');
if (_dio == null) {
return AppIntentResult.failed(error: 'API client not initialized');
}
try {
final response = await _dio!.get(
'/messager/chat/$channelId/messages',
queryParameters: {'offset': 0, 'take': limit},
);
final messages = response.data as List;
if (messages.isEmpty) {
return AppIntentResult.successful(
value: 'No messages found in channel $channelId',
needsToContinueInApp: false,
);
}
final formattedMessages = messages
.map((msg) {
final senderName =
msg['sender']?['account']?['name'] ?? 'Unknown';
final messageContent = msg['content'] ?? '';
return '$senderName: $messageContent';
})
.join('\n');
talker.info('[AppIntents] Retrieved ${messages.length} messages');
return AppIntentResult.successful(
value: formattedMessages,
needsToContinueInApp: false,
);
} on DioException catch (e) {
talker.error('[AppIntents] API error reading messages', e);
return AppIntentResult.failed(
error: 'Failed to read messages: ${e.message ?? 'Network error'}',
);
}
} catch (e, stack) {
talker.error('[AppIntents] Failed to read messages', e, stack);
return AppIntentResult.failed(error: 'Failed to read messages: $e');
}
}
